U.N. Secretary General Javier Perez de Cuellar ended negotiations with Iranian and Iraqi officials on implementing a cease-fire in the seven-year-old Persian Gulf War with no sign of progress, officials said. Perez de Cuellar is expected to report the two countries’ positions to the 15-nation Security Council today, which will then have to decide on the next move. Foreign Minister Tarik Aziz told reporters that Iraq is ready to stop fighting and accepts the Security Council’s July 20 cease-fire resolution without any conditions.
